Social media offers significant benefits for lawyers. However, these benefits present huge risks for lawyers and law firms if not managed properly. This presentation aims to address ethical issues which may arise from the use of social media and strategies for mitigating those risks.

Barrister, Francis Burt Chambers
Philippa Honey specialises in commercial litigation and arbitration. Since being admitted to practice in 2010, she has acquired particular expertise in contract law, trade practices and corporations law. She has represented clients in all Courts, mainly in the Supreme Court of Western Australia and the District Court of Western Australia. Having worked for a range of clients – including port authorities, major and mid-tier mining companies, pastoralists and private individuals – Philippa understands the importance of tailoring a litigation strategy to reach a commercial outcome. Prior to coming to the Independent Bar, Philippa was a Senior Associate in Lavan’s Litigation and Dispute Resolution Team.
